What: A high-level discussion of FFF single particle ICP-MS as it stands, and where we can go in the future. The enumeration, size analysis, and characterization of chemical composition of nanoparticles and colloidal particles facilitates the study of biogeochemical cycling, contaminant transport, mineral exploration, and a host of other fields. Over the past decade, ICP-based methodologies, including single particle ICP-MS (spICP-MS) and Field-Flow Fractionation coupled to ICP-MS, have developed the ability to provide unique insights.
